Cranberry Bars

  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 16 bars 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Cranberry Bars are a delicious dessert that combines a buttery, crumbly crust with a sweet-tart cranberry sauce filling. Perfect for using leftover cranberry sauce, these bars are easy to make, customizable, and make a great addition to any dessert table.


Ingredients

  • 3/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up cranberry sauce

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a 9×9-inch pan with parchment paper, letting the parchment overhang the sides.
  2. In a large bowl, combine melted butter and sugar. Add the flour, baking powder, vanilla extract, cinnamon, and salt, mixing until the mixture is crumbly.
  3. Press half of the crumbly mixture into the bottom of the prepared pan to form the crust.
  4. Spread the cranberry sauce evenly over the crust.
  5. Sprinkle the remaining crumb mixture over the cranberry sauce.
  6. Bake for 30 minutes or until the crust turns golden brown. Allow to cool before slicing into bars.
